can infection pass from mom to baby during breastfeeding??if mother has fever or cold ???

A. It is ok to nurse baby while having cough and cold infections, infact via feed antibodies generated in mother’s body to fight the infection passes on to baby. Infection can only pass through external factors, such as sneezing around the baby or touching or holding baby too close to nose or without washing hands. Mother can wear mask while nursing and maintain proper hygiene to avoid infection.
